When we think of Amol Palekar, we fondly remember heart-warming romantic comedies like Chhoti Si Baat, Chitchor and Gol Maal.Hemchhaya De looks at the body of work that made him our favourite everyman.
Principle of the thing
“Amol uncle is soft-spoken, but if he wants something done in a particular way, he’ll make sure it’s done without being too forceful,” says Chaiti Ghoshal, acclaimed Bengali TV, theatre and film actor, who worked with Palekar for a TV series called Krishnakali (2006), commissioned by Doordarshan. But Ghoshal’s association with him goes back to the mid-80s when he played the lead in her father Shyamal Ghoshal’s Bengali film, Britto about jute mill workers. “I was just a child when I first met him and he was a big star. He was making blockbusters with filmmakers like Basu Chatterjee and Hrishikesh Mukherjee,” recalls Ghoshal. Although she was just a child at that time, Ghoshal remembers that Palekar worked like any other member of the film unit.
